Brief summary
Coronary artery disease (CAD) is a major chronic condition severely impacting population health in China. Our previous cohort studies revealed a high comorbidity rate between CAD and frailty, suggesting their interrelated equivalence as clinical syndromes with shared risk factors. In recent years, pilot integrated health management initiatives in China have demonstrated promising outcomes, yet evidence remains scarce regarding patients with concurrent CAD and frailty-a critical gap needing urgent resolution to achieve the Healthy China 2030 strategic goals. Building on prior research, this project aims to systematically evaluate existing management models for patients with CAD and frailty, develop a tailored health management framework, and implement it in clinical settings through empirical studies. The model will be optimized according to regional and demographic variations, leveraging cardiac rehabilitation centers, exercise-based interventions, and internet-enabled technologies to enhance coordinated care. By improving exercise efficacy, mitigating frailty progression, and enhancing quality of life, this initiative seeks to establish a robust chronic disease management system. The findings will provide evidence for formulating regional health policy and insurance strategies in Anhui Province, ultimately improving standardized management rates for chronic diseases.

Eligibility
Inclusion criteria
* Diagnosis of Coronary heart disease; * Proficiency in smartphone use; * Absence of visual, auditory, cognitive, or motor impairments.
Exclusion criteria
* Inability or unwillingness to provide informed consent; * Physical or cognitive limitations preventing app operation; * Inability to attend in-person follow-up visits; * Concurrent severe comorbidities or malignancies, such as severe valvular heart disease, New York Heart Association class IV heart failure, severe aortic regurgitation, cancer, end-stage renal or liver disease; * Any other condition that could potentially impede exercise participation.
Design outcomes
Primary
| Measure | Time frame | Description |
|---|---|---|
| 6MWD | 1month,3 months, 6 months | Measuring the maximum distance within 6 minutes. |
| The MOS item short from health survey | 1month,3 months, 6 months | Quality of life was assessed using the 36-Item Short Form Health Survey questionnaire |
Secondary
| Measure | Time frame | Description |
|---|---|---|
| Gait speed | 1month,3 months, 6 months | Stopwatch |
| Physical activity level | 1month,3 months, 6 months | The short version self-reported International Physical Activity Questionnaire. |
| Frailty | 1month,3 months, 6 months | The FRAIL Scale |
| Major cardiovascular adverse events | 1month,3 months, 6 months | Major Adverse Cardiovascular Events (MACE) were defined as at least one of the following: heart failure, malignant arrhythmia, recurrent angina, recurrent myocardial infarction, cardiogenic shock, cardiac arrest, or sudden cardiac death. |
| Changes in Blood Lipid Biomarkers | 1 month, 3 months, 6 months | Changes in blood lipid biomarkers, including triglycerides (TG), total cholesterol (TC), low-density lipoprotein cholesterol (LDL-C), and high-density lipoprotein cholesterol (HDL-C), were assessed. |
| Systolic pressure/Diastolic pressure | 1month,3 months, 6 months | Calibrated electronic blood pressure monitor |
| Grip strength | 1month,3 months, 6 months | Electronic grip device |
